2. Freshness
If you purchase coffee from shops, the beans have been ground some time ago. By the time they are in your mug, their unique flavour will disappear. Bean-to-cup machines offer the option of grinding whole beans and then brew fresh at home, so you can drink your favourite coffee with the best flavor.
If you love cappuccinos and lattes, then the best bean-to cup machines for milk-based drinks will feature an integrated steamer and a frother. It will be much easier to create creamy, layered milk-based drinks by pressing a single button.
Typically, these machines have a variety of settings that allow you to adjust the strength of your Coffee To Cup Machine as well as regulate the temperature. Some of the more expensive models allow you to alter the size of the grind to get the most flavor.

3. Cleanliness is convenient
Unlike traditional coffee machines beans machines that use pre-ground beans which are prone to becoming stale and lose their full flavor, bean-to-cup machines grind the beans right before making every drink, ensuring the most fresh and delicious taste. They are the ideal choice for anyone who wants a great cup of coffee without having to buy fresh beans or wait for the office kettle.
You only need to choose your preferred drink from the display and the machine will take care of the rest. It will grind the beans to cup coffee machines to the appropriate size for the beverage, then boil and steam the milk to perfection, and then serve it immediately. It's an easy process and it's incredibly quick as well it will save your time and money.
Many bean to cup machines have a descaling system that helps keep the machine clean. This is essential, especially in areas with hard water. Limescale can buildup inside the machine, reducing the flow of water. Regular cleaning can help to extend the lifespan of your bean to cup machine and avoid costly call-out charges.
